The Importance of Mind-Body Connection
Developing a strong mind-body connection is essential for overall well-being. It allows you to be more in tune with your body's signals, improve coordination, reduce stress, and enhance performance in physical activities.
Exercise #1: Yoga
Yoga is a fantastic way to improve your mind-body connection. It combines physical postures, breathing techniques, and meditation to help you focus on the present moment and connect with your body.

Exercise #2: Tai Chi
Tai Chi is a gentle form of martial arts that emphasizes slow, flowing movements and deep breathing. It promotes relaxation, balance, and mental clarity, making it an excellent practice for enhancing the mind-body connection.

Benefits of Pilates for Flexibility
Pilates is a low-impact exercise method that focuses on strengthening muscles while improving flexibility and posture. It targets the deep stabilizing muscles of the core, helping you achieve long, lean muscles and increased range of motion.
Key Pilates Exercises for Flexibility
- Roll-Up: Strengthens the core and stretches the spine.
- Swan Dive: Improves back flexibility and strengthens the upper body.
- Mermaid Stretch: Increases flexibility in the side body and hips.
By incorporating these Pilates exercises into your routine, you can gradually increase your flexibility, reduce the risk of injury, and enhance your overall physical performance.
